Checking the operation of the rear window defroster timer
1. Disconnect the battery from the ground.
2. Pry and remove the switch from the panel and disconnect the connector.
3. Check for continuity between pins 1 and 3 of the relay side connector (see fig. Numbering of conclusions of a socket of the switch of heating of back glass). If there is no circuit between the terminals, then check the lamp.
4. Check the heater timer. To do this, connect () - battery terminal with terminal 2, and (-) - output - with output 4 switches, between () - Connect a 3.4 W lamp with the battery terminal and terminal 6 (see fig. Checking the operation of the rear window defroster timer). Press the switch - the test and control lamps of the switch should light up and go out after 12-18 minutes. Otherwise, replace the switch.
5. Check the circuit at the connector side of the switch.
6. Between terminal 4 and ground, the circuit must be constant.
7. When the ignition key is in the ACC or LOCK positions, there should be no voltage between pins 2 or 6 and ground.
8. When the ignition key is in the ON position, terminals 2 or 6 and ground should be energized.
9. Connect pins 4 and 6 and check that the heater is working properly.
10. If the results of one of the checks are negative, then replace the switch.
11. Check the heater relay - there should be a circuit between terminals 1 and 2. When powering pins 1 and 2 (12 V) the circuit must be between terminals 3 and 5. The relay is located in the fuse box in the passenger compartment.
12. If the results of one of the checks are negative, then replace the relay.
